Iconic London landmark could become luxury hotel with 179 rooms and a spa
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



Previous plans to develop London’s Custom House have been rejected, but real estate company Jastar Capital is now looking to turn the Grade I listed property into a luxury hotel with a spa, café, and restaurant. Plans promise new windows, a spa, and public access all year, with a focus on sensitively upgrading the historically important parts of the building while enhancing its architectural features. The proposed revitalization aims to bring this iconic London landmark back to life, with hopes of creating welcoming community spaces and exceptional dining experiences.
